The cheapest way to get from Gradignan to Montpellier is to bus via Toulouse which costs €14 - €40 and takes 8h 19m.
The fastest way to get from Gradignan to Montpellier is to drive which takes 4h 22m and costs €70 - €110.
No, there is no direct bus from Gradignan to Montpellier. However, there are services departing from Eglise de Gradignan and arriving at Montpellier via Bordeaux.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 35m.
The distance between Gradignan and Montpellier is 514 km. The road distance is 477.1 km.
The best way to get from Gradignan to Montpellier without a car is to train which takes 6h 20m and costs €27 - €60.
It takes approximately 6h 20m to get from Gradignan to Montpellier, including transfers.
Gradignan to Montpellier b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Bordeaux station.
The best way to get from Gradignan to Montpellier is to train which takes 6h 20m and costs €27 - €60.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€22 - €50 and takes 7h 35m.
Gradignan to Montpellier b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Montpellier station.
Yes, the driving distance between Gradignan to Montpellier is 477 km. It takes approximately 4h 22m to drive from Gradignan to Montpellier.
What companies run services between Gradignan, France and Montpellier, France?
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F) operates a train from Bordeaux St Jean to Montpellier Saint-Roch every 4 hours. Tickets cost €26–55 and the journey takes 4h 42m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Bordeaux to Montpellier 3 times a day. Tickets cost €21–45 and the journey takes 5h 55m.
